When it comes to the world of property management, you want to always be on the lookout for ways to create a strong sense of community and loyalty among the residents. Resident appreciation programs are a strategic approach you can take to achieve this goal.

These programs go far beyond routine maintenance and rent collection. Instead, they focus on creating a vibrant and engaging community atmosphere that the residents are proud to call home.

Benefits of Resident Appreciation Programs

Here are just a few of the benefits you will find when you choose to show gratitude to residents and improve their living experience.

Increased Resident Retention

Happy residents are more likely to renew their lease. Appreciation programs foster a sense of belonging and satisfaction and can reduce turnover rates. This kind of stability is also beneficial for property managers because it helps minimize the costs and efforts associated with finding new residents and preparing units for move-in.

Enhanced Community Atmosphere

Regular events and initiatives encourage interaction among residents while building a greater sense of community. When residents form bonds with their neighbors, their overall satisfaction with their living environment increases. This leads to more harmonious and cooperative communities.

Positive Reputation and Referrals

A community with a strong appreciation program can develop a more positive reputation. Satisfied residents are more likely to leave positive reviews online and refer friends and family. This word-of-mouth marketing can be invaluable when attracting new residents.

Implementing Effective Resident Appreciation Programs

To create an impactful resident appreciation program, property managers should consider these steps:

  1. Know Your Residents: Understanding the demographics and preferences of your resident community is so important. Tailor your appreciation initiatives to their interests and lifestyles. For instance, young professionals might appreciate networking events or fitness classes, while families might prefer movie nights or activities for their children.
  2. Consistent Communication: Regularly inform residents about upcoming events and initiatives through newsletters, social media, and community boards. Clear and consistent communication ensures high participation and engagement.
  3. Diverse Activities: Offer a variety of activities to cater to these different interests. This inclusivity ensures that residents feel recognized and valued. Mix large-scale events with smaller, more personal gestures like birthday cards or door-to-door treats.
  4. Feedback and Improvement: Regularly seek out feedback from residents to gauge the success of your programs and identify areas of improvement. This shows residents that their opinions matter and you are committed to enhancing their living experience.
